Output 66727004734fcb53862217140b7b4085e10f19119180441653f60bfc59fc477a:1

value
31364426
script pubkey
OP_0 OP_PUSHBYTES_20 e98bc99bcf54323728efe61865e625b34b1ea598
address
ltc1qax9unx702serw280ucvxte39kd93afvc2t8cgt
transaction
66727004734fcb53862217140b7b4085e10f19119180441653f60bfc59fc477a
spent
true